Output d5ebd487f5212868fa26ef17f4b644b57c2b67cb2fa5fb11dc0aef53deffef27:2

value
89026506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c601132dc614529b13a4c2f198ee1da39790ec OP_EQUAL
address
MSqmJiFTTxuFPi49dw345cpYhCVdHHxDAM
transaction
d5ebd487f5212868fa26ef17f4b644b57c2b67cb2fa5fb11dc0aef53deffef27
spent
true